Burmese Okra and Shrimp Stir-Fry

A vibrant and quick stir-fry featuring tender okra and succulent shrimp, brought together with aromatic garlic, ginger, and a hint of chili. This dish showcases the fresh flavors and simple preparation common in Burmese home cooking.

Tiempo de Preparación15 minutes
Tiempo de Cocción10 minutes
Tiempo Total25 minutes
Porciones3
DificultadEasy

🧂 Ingredientes

  • 250 g Okra(wiped clean and sliced into 1/4 inch rounds)
  • 200 g Fresh shrimp(peeled and deveined)
  • 4 cloves Garlic(minced)
  • 1 tbsp Ginger(minced)
  • 1-2 Green chilies(minced, or to taste)
  • 1/2 tbsp Shrimp paste(optional, for deeper flavor)
  • 2 tbsp Vegetable oil
  • 1 tbsp Fish sauce
  • to taste Salt
  • 1 tsp Sugar
  • 1/4 cup Cilantro(chopped, for garnish)

💡 Consejos de Profesional

  • Ensure the okra is dry before slicing to minimize sliminess.
  • Do not overcrowd the pan; cook in batches if necessary.
  • Adjust the amount of chili to your preferred spice level.
  • Shrimp paste adds a distinct umami flavor, but can be omitted if preferred.

Ideas de "Twist"

Inspiración para tu propia versión de esta receta

  • Add thinly sliced shallots along with the garlic and ginger.
  • A splash of lime juice at the end can add a bright, fresh note.
  • For a vegetarian version, omit the shrimp and shrimp paste, and consider adding firm tofu.
